An idea struck me whilst I was making up the Antenocitis Billboards and adding the Dreadball poster in particular. What if there where street style Dreadball pitches, like you see in basketball and football in real life? Not something like used in Xtreme, but something used by the kids and adults alike of the cities and colonies. With that in mind I set out to try and figure out the best way to make something like that and discovered this on Antenocitis Workshop:
This would work really well to get the main shape onto a base. I had a couple of wooden backs from frames lying about, intended for basing some terrain, so cut one to the size I wanted, 3 x 2 cubes or 9″ x 6″. With that base size in place I had a limit to the size of the pitch and how much of the above to cut into shape and size, I wanted it a little smaller than the base so I could add a few extra bits around the edges, specifically some barriers and some strike posts. Using some of the Antenocitis barriers, a few bits of Deadzone terrain, metal tubing and a wee bit of guitar string, this is what I came up with…
It looks a little small when compared with the size of the figures, but I think any larger and it would take up way too much space on the board, and I think at the end of the day it does what it’s supposed to do- add a characterful piece of terrain to the board, something that makes it look like people did at one time or another live and play in the Deadzone 🙂
Now to get the blighter painted 😀
